District Scooters and their parts range are some of the most iconic original stunt scooter parts out there. In more recent year District have focused their attention on more complete scooters including the intermediate completes in particular - the District C50 and C152 Scooters are particularly popular as a mid level complete as the parts are fully changeable or can be upgraded. Whilst the District C253 Scooter, features a premium end deck and number of other parts.

They regularly release signature decks, fork, bars and clamp sets for their riders and have been respected for supporting the develop of the stunt scooter scene since the foundations of the sport. As one of the pioneers of the sport, they've launched some creative designs, and brought very lightweight bars and parts to the market. District is as well known a brand as stunt scooters come by. District are obsessed with improvement of both the art and sport of freestyle scooter riding.

Launched in 2007 by the FSP Group, the brand was launched by Marcel Oosterveen alongside Eagle Wheels. The brand helped launch the worlds first lightweight scooters and parts, including the worlds first aluminium bars. Some of the worlds best known OG riders represent District including Helmeri, Rory Coe, Cam Ward, Fernando Young and Hep Grey. Coedie is known for being one of the innovators in the sport, so it is only fitting that he rides for one of the most innovative companies in the industry. District has always tried to stay true to it's principles of creating the best products for the sport.

Because of the way District was structured unlike other companies they're able to manufacture the products directly themselves meaning that they have an increased level of control over the quality of the products made. District listen to their riders feedback worldwide and implement the designs and technical features of scooter products desired by the riders. Based out of Rotterdam, Netherlands the products are designed from there, whilst manufactured in China.

The District C Series Scooters are now the most popular complete scooters from District, whilst the decks and bars are built with weight in mind for the riders. The District products regularly feature fun, creative and engaging graphics.
